Transaction d2f0f9b934122e88f59667cc2be11bf57040d8cef98dedd9ed152c74124cd669

block
2618f0c2409ed29d5735abdea243d267d3b0f3d5aa685758fa7259844afbaf9c

1 Input

24 Outputs